It's an interesting question. Technically, though the president can't unilaterally grant them citizenship, granting a general amnesty could fall under Article II powers to grant reprieves and pardons for crimes against the United States--in this case illegal entry and/or evasion of authorities, taxes, etc (or whatever the applicable statutes are). I don't think there's a precedent on this scale. I'd imagine the amnesty granted following the Civil War would be the largest in US History, but I haven't verified that. On the other hand, there is an argument to be made that he failed to "take care that the laws be faithfully executed" on a fairly grand scale. Other presidents have done this to one degree or another, but this may constitute a substantial departure.

Now, I haven't seen any reliable indication that this is his plan (a formal proclomation of amnesty) and think it would be politically toxic.
